Ezekiel 20:18-20
Christian Standard Bible
18 “‘Then I said to their children in the wilderness, “Don’t follow the statutes of your fathers, defile yourselves with their idols, or keep their ordinances.(A) 19 I am the Lord your God. Follow my statutes, keep my ordinances, and practice them.(B) 20 Keep my Sabbaths holy,(C) and they will be a sign between me and you, so you may know that I am the Lord your God.”

Ezekiel 20:18-20
New International Version
18 I said to their children in the wilderness, “Do not follow the statutes of your parents(A) or keep their laws or defile yourselves(B) with their idols. 19 I am the Lord your God;(C) follow my decrees and be careful to keep my laws.(D) 20 Keep my Sabbaths(E) holy, that they may be a sign(F) between us. Then you will know that I am the Lord your God.(G)”
